As of 17 October 2025, the valuation grade for Yash Chemex has moved from expensive to very attractive, indicating a significant improvement in its valuation outlook. The company is currently assessed as undervalued. Key ratios include a PE ratio of 60.41, an EV to EBITDA of 95.12, and a PEG ratio of 0.14, which suggests that the stock is trading at a lower valuation relative to its growth potential compared to peers.

In comparison to its peers, Yash Chemex stands out with a much lower PEG ratio than Solar Industries, which has a PEG of 2.77, and Gujarat Fluoroch, with a PEG of 0.80. Additionally, while Yash Chemex has a higher PE ratio than Godrej Industries at 36.08, its overall valuation metrics indicate a more attractive investment opportunity. The company's stock has significantly outperformed the Sensex, with a year-to-date return of 103.49% compared to the Sensex's 7.44%, reinforcing the notion that Yash Chemex is currently undervalued.
